  • Calculate and Select Ball Mill Ball Size for Optimum Grinding

    Based on his work, this formula can be derived for ball diameter sizing and selection: Dm <= 6 (log dk) * d^0.5 where D m = the diameter of the single-sized balls in mm.d = the diameter of the largest chunks of ore in the mill feed in mm.

  • Mill Steel Charge Volume Calculation

    We can calculate the steel charge volume of a ball or rod mill and express it as the % of the volume within the liners that is filled with grinding media. While the mill is stopped, the charge volume can be gotten by measuring the diameter inside the liners and the distance from the top of the charge to the top of the mill.

  • How to choose the size, filling ... - Alumina grinding ball

    The hardness of the high alumina ceramic ball is 9, and the density is 3.6. g/cm³, in the wet milling process, when the filling amount of the balls reaches 55% of the net volume of the ball mill, the best state can be achieved. The weight of the balls in the ball mill can be estimated with an empirical formula.
